Understanding Licensing and Regulation

One of the primary differentiating factors of a non-UK casino is its licensing jurisdiction. While the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is renowned for its strict standards, other reputable licensing bodies exist, such as those in Malta, Gibraltar, Curacao, and Panama. Each jurisdiction has its own set of rules and regulations governing casino operations, player protection, and responsible gambling. It's essential to investigate the licensing body of a casino before depositing funds, ensuring it’s a recognized and respected authority. A legitimate license indicates that the casino adheres to certain standards of fairness and security. Casinos licensed in these locations are often subject to audits and ongoing monitoring to ensure compliance.

The level of player protection can vary significantly between different licensing jurisdictions. The UKGC is considered one of the most robust, offering strong support for responsible gambling, dispute resolution, and preventing money laundering. While other regulators are improving their standards, it's important to be aware of the differences. Players should research the specific protections offered by the licensing authority of the non-UK casino they’re considering. This includes looking into complaint procedures, deposit limits, and self-exclusion options. Due diligence is key to mitigating potential risks associated with operating outside the UK regulatory framework.

The Importance of Security Certifications

Beyond the licensing jurisdiction, look for casinos that possess security certifications from independent testing agencies such as e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) or iTech Labs. These certifications verify that the casino's games are fair and that the random number generators (RNGs) used are unbiased. These independent audits provide an extra layer of assurance for players, confirming that the games haven't been manipulated in any way and that the results are genuinely random. A casino displaying these logos demonstrates a commitment to transparency and fairness. This certification process helps to build trust between the casino and its players.

Furthermore, secure socket layer (SSL) encryption is a non-negotiable feature. Verify that the casino website uses SSL encryption to protect your personal and financial information during transmission. Look for "https://" in the website address and a padlock icon in your browser’s address bar. This indicates that the connection is secure and your data is encrypted, preventing unauthorized access. Ignoring these security features can expose you to the risk of identity theft and financial fraud. A trustworthy casino prioritizes the security of its players’ data.

Navigating Payment Options

Payment methods available on a non uk casino site can differ significantly from those commonly used in the UK. While credit cards are often accepted, many international casinos also embrace alternative payment solutions like e-wallets (Skrill, Neteller, ecoPayz), cryptocurrencies (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in), and bank transfers. The availability of specific methods can vary depending on the casino’s target market and licensing jurisdiction. Understanding the associated fees, processing times, and security protocols of each method is crucial. For example, cryptocurrencies offer enhanced privacy and faster transactions, but they also come with potential price volatility.

Be wary of casinos that promote unusually high deposit or withdrawal limits. These limits can sometimes be indicative of underlying issues, such as difficulties in processing payments or potential restrictions on cash-outs. Always read the casino’s terms and conditions carefully to understand the specific limitations. It’s also prudent to test the withdrawal process with a small amount before attempting to withdraw larger sums. This ensures that the casino’s withdrawal system is functioning correctly and that you can successfully access your winnings. Prompt and reliable payouts are a hallmark of a reputable online casino.

Payment Method Pros Cons
Credit/Debit Cards Widely accepted, secure Potential for bank interference, slower processing
E-wallets (Skrill, Neteller) Fast transactions, enhanced security Fees may apply, not always eligible for bonuses
Cryptocurrencies Anonymity, fast payouts Volatility, regulatory uncertainties

Understanding the nuances of each payment method is key to choosing one that suits your individual needs and preferences. Furthermore, be mindful of potential currency conversion fees when depositing or withdrawing funds in a currency different from your own.
